?Key duties and responsibilities of our Income Officer:

  • Provide a responsive service to customers' enquiries in relation to their rent account.
  • Monitor rent accounts with an arrears balance daily and ensure prompt contact with the customer using a variety of methods, such as letters, outbound calls, text messages, emails and home visits where necessary.
  • Provide non-judgemental, firm but fair advice to tenants to establish an understanding of the help and support that is available, what their responsibilities are and what is required for them to resolve their situation.
  • Work proactively and in partnership with internal and external support services, such as the Tenants First Team, CAB, Credit Union to assist customers in sustaining their tenancies.
  • Prepare and hand-deliver legal Notices of Seeking Possession and Notices of Possession Proceedings including supporting documentation.
  • Ensure a customer focused approach is adopted in all aspects of the service.
  • Ensure that the needs of customers both internal and external are met by providing the best quality of service.
  • Deal with sensitive information with regard to confidentiality, data protection and freedom of information.
